Zuallererst können Ausnahmeklassen in Java angepasst werden. Wie kann man also Ausnahmeklassen in Java anpassen?
(Empfohlenes Tutorial: Java-Einführungs-Tutorial)
1. Schreiben Sie zuerst eine Klasse, erben Sie eine Ausnahme oder erben Sie eine RuntimeException. 2 Es gibt zwei Konstruktoren, einen ohne Parameter und einen mit String-Parametern. Schreiben Sie einfach super(s) mit Parametern in den Methodenkörper.Java-Video-Tutorial)
Code-Implementierung:public class Test13 { public static void main(String[] args) { // 创建自定义异常类的实例,并不抛出 MyStackOperatorException e = new MyStackOperatorException("栈操作有误"); String msg = e.getMessage(); System.out.println(msg); // 栈操作有误 e.printStackTrace(); // exception.MyStackOperatorException: 栈操作有误 //at exception.Test13.main(Test13.java:23) } // 自定义异常类 class MyStackOperatorException extends Exception { public MyStackOperatorException() { } public MyStackOperatorException(String s) { super(s); } }
Das obige ist der detaillierte Inhalt vonKönnen Ausnahmeklassen in Java angepasst werden?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!